9 Truth about EMR 8 Truths of EMR Selecting an EMR is HARD-NO PERFECT EMR People make decisions, EMR is just a TOOL that helps EMR WILL NOT fix poor workflow/performers ALL departments need to be included On-going software maintenance and training are CRITICAL to success Workflow MUST be changed Productivity is REDUCED when implementing new features EMR is a series of overlapping investments whose benefit accumulates OVER TIME 17 Key EMR Modules and Functionality Clinical Modules Financial Modules Census/ADT MDS Document Management Business Intelligence, Analytics Care Plans Physician Orders Assessments Progress Notes e-mar/e-tar Weights/Vitals Point of Care Third Party Software: Therapy QI/QA (Interact, COMS) Billing/Claims Management Accounts Receivable Collections Referral Management Patient Trust Accounts Payable General Ledger 18 HMM Consulting 9
10 Key EMR Modules and Functionality Key functionality to look for: Logical and effective workflow built-in Do you want software to drive you through the documentation process or alert you to documentation required (matter of preference) Clinical Decision Support Software (CDSS) and other logic checks Alerts/Warnings/Messaging/Prompts Parameters exceeded (temps outside of normal range) Documentation to be completed for an Event Duplicate orders (Rx, lab or other tests) Past due accounts Claims data missing or inconsistent (onset date, diagnosis code) 19 Key EMR Modules and Functionality Key functionality (continued): Interfaces - Standard and Custom Ability to communicate and transmit orders electronically Pharmacy, Lab, Radiology, Physician referrals, etc. Document Management Ability to incorporate third party documents to ensure chart integrity and completeness Lab, radiology results, Physician consults, etc. Healthcare Proxy, DNR, or other Advanced Directives Benefit Cards (Medicare, Medicaid, Other Insurance) 20 HMM Consulting 10
11 Critical Ingredients For Success Managing EMR Expectations: Timeframe No instant gratification multiple stages over months or years Productivity/Workflow Workflow WILL/MUST change Users will experience inefficiencies at various stages of the project (expect overtime) There will be trial and error Won t fix poor performing employees Resources Clearly identify project lead one person ANNUAL BUDGET for hardware and on-going training to use new features and functions as they become available Compliance Monitor and enforce consistent utilization by all users (QA) Update Policies and Procedures, Staff education, etc. Tie compliance to job performance 21 Thank you.?
